Categories > TinyButStrong general (FR) >

regroupement (headergrp) avec plugin excel

The forum is closed. Please use Stack Overflow for submitting new questions. Use tags: tinybutstrong , opentbs
By: Michel
Date: 2010-12-10
Time: 12:43

regroupement (headergrp) avec plugin excel

j'essaie d'adapter un regroupement avec le plugin excel mais j'ai une erreur "table" à la sortie.
avant de poursuivre, est-ce possible ?
j'avoue que je ne sais pas par quoi commencer (regroupement sur categinscrit)
[a.CategInscrit;block=Row+Row;ope=xlNum]
[sub.childname;block=Row;p1=[a.CategInscrit]]
merci par avance
By: Skrol29
Date: 2010-12-10
Time: 22:26

Re: regroupement (headergrp) avec plugin excel

Bonjour,

Oui, c'est possible. Tu veux ajouter une entête de groupe sur le sous-bloc "sub" ?
By: Michel
Date: 2010-12-11
Time: 08:43

Re: regroupement (headergrp) avec plugin excel

En fait je me suis mal exprimé - désolé

l'exemple du plugin excel "books in stock" correspond à mon besoin et fonctionne très bien avec mes données.

Je souhaite si possible faire un regroupement pour séparer deux catégories d'inscrits qui sont en texte dans ma  bdd (A et E) donc déjà mon "ope=xlNum" n'est pas bon dans mon exemple précédent et je n'ai pas besoin de sous-bloc.
J'ai tenté une adaptation avec headergrp mais j'ai toujours une erreur "table"
[a.CategInscrit;block=Row;headergrp=CategInscrit]                   
                                                                                                            Total:    0                             #VALEUR!
civilite                            nom    prénom                     Longueur                            Tarif                                             A  régler
[a.CivExposant;block=Row]    [a.NomExpo] [a.PrenExpo]     [a.Longueur;ope=xlNum]     [a.TarifApplicable;ope=xlNum]    #VALEUR!
            Total:    0     #VALEUR!
[a.CategInscrit;block=Row;footergrp=CategInscrit]                   

Je ne sais pas comment m'y prendre ?
un petit coup de main serait le bienvenu - merci par avance
By: Skrol29
Date: 2010-12-13
Time: 14:22

Re: regroupement (headergrp) avec plugin excel

Salut Michel,

Je constate le même problème quand j'essaie de reproduire ta fusion.

Le problème que j'ai identifié, c'est que PHP génère des Warning et des Notice à cause de la version de PHP et de TBS.
À cause de ces alertes PHP, la fin du fichier XML est tronquée lorsqu'on est en mode téléchargement.
La solution c'est d'annuler les alertes PHP de niveau bas. Par exemple (à ajouter avant l'inclusion de la classe TBS) :
pour PHP>=5.3
error_reporting(E_ALL ^ E_NOTICE ^ E_DEPRECATED);
et pour PHP<5.3
error_reporting(E_ALL ^ E_NOTICE);

Le plugin Excel fonctionne avec TBS version 3.1.1 maximum. Au delà de cette version, le plug-in peut générer des bugs inattendus. je n'ai pas encore mis à jour le plug-in pour améliorer cela.
Je suis en train de regarder si c'est facile de mettre à jour le plugin.
By: Michel
Date: 2010-12-13
Time: 18:24

Re: regroupement (headergrp) avec plugin excel

Merci encore Skrol29.
Échec sur ce coup après de nombreuses tentatives. Partie remise sans acharnement ...
Le regroupement est peut-être à faire au niveau table ? je suis un peu largué sur ce coup.
je vais m'y prendre différemment car le regroupement fonctionne très bien avec OOo calc (après tout c'est fait pour !)
Je consulterai le forum de temps à autre pour voir si une solution est trouvée a condition que mon problème intéresse d'autres utilisateurs que moi.
Cordialement
Michel
By: Skrol29
Date: 2010-12-13
Time: 21:22

Re: regroupement (headergrp) avec plugin excel

Si tu n'y arrives pas, envoie moi un bout de code qui reproduit le problème.